The Future Court

By The Daily Dish
Feb 26 2008, 1:33 AM ET

Jeff Rosen explains why the Dems have a shortage of SCOTUS candidates ready on Day One. It's as good a time as any to repeat my own suggestion. A president Obama should offer the first SCOTUS vacancy to Senator Clinton. It's perfect for her: she gets to lord it over others, she's a sharp lawyer, it appeals to her vanity, she doesn't have to get elected, and as a sitting senator, she'd be a shoo-in. The base would love it.
